Obituary for Geraldine Wellworth (Mahar)

WATERVLIET – Geraldine Mahar Wellworth entered into eternal life on Thursday, August 9, 2018 at her home in Watervliet. She was 86 years of age.

Born in Troy, Geraldine was the daughter of Jeremiah and Mabel Elizabeth (Brown) Mahar. By the time she reached the age of four, Geraldine’s parents had both passed away and she was raised, in Watervliet, by her aunts Mamie and Lollie. She was a graduate of Watervliet High School and furthered her education at the Albany Business College.

Geraldine was retired from the First Albany Corporation where she worked as a receptionist for many years.

Geraldine was a faith-filled woman who was very devoted to her Catholic faith. She was a life-long and active parishioner of the former St. Patrick’s Church in Watervliet where she served as a lector and as the religious education coordinator for both St. Patrick’s Church and Sacred Heart of Mary Church. She also taught second grade religious education and each year coordinated the communion class; volunteered at the annual flea market and spaghetti suppers; founded the food pantry with former pastor, the late Rev. Erwin Schweigardt and, along with her daughter Donna, presented the offertory gifts at the last parish Mass before the closing of the church in 2011. She had also served as PTA president for the former School 3 in Watervliet.

In retirement Geraldine enjoyed her family and her home where five generations of her family have resided. She loved to travel and take cruises. She was a communicant of the Immaculate Heart of Mary Parish in Watervliet.
